Output 34b85d10355970650dbf987ce0ebc1d9ca65e7c81fb4bc1fe9768b7584cda258:7

value
127525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21cad641d67ea398282a1d9dcf7e31e6c4eb3c7 OP_EQUAL
address
3PmBoW1r2L7C3SYpBZnKZuzuEqrQJDVHRN
transaction
34b85d10355970650dbf987ce0ebc1d9ca65e7c81fb4bc1fe9768b7584cda258
spent
true